Savory Beef Meatballs in Mushroom Sauce

Ingredients:

For the Meatballs:

  • 1 lb ground beef

  • 1/3 cup breadcrumbs

  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an

  • 1 egg

  • 2 cloves garlic, minced

  • 1 teaspoon onion powder

  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ning

  • 1/2 teaspoon salt

  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il (for browning)

For the Mushroom Sauce:

  • 2 tablespoons butter

  • 8 oz mushrooms, sliced

  • 1 small onion, finely diced

  • 2 cloves garlic, minced

  • 1 tablespoon flour

  • 1 cup beef broth

  • 1 cup heavy cream

  • 1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ce

  • Salt and pepper to taste

  • Fresh parsley for garnish

Instructions:

  1. In a bowl, mix ground beef, breadcrumbs, Parmesan, egg, garlic, onion powder,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per until combined. Shape into 1-inch meatballs.

  2.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Brown meatballs on all sides. Remove and keep warm.

  3. In the same skillet, melt butter. Add mushrooms and onion, cooking until softened.

  4. Add garlic and stir 1 minute. Sprinkle in flour and cook another minute.

  5. Pour in beef broth, stirring until thickened slightly. Add heavy cream and Worcestershire sauce. Season with salt and pepper.

  6. Return meatballs to skillet. Simmer 10–12 minutes until cooked through and sauce is creamy.

  7. Serve over mashed potatoes, egg noodles, or rice. Garnish with fresh parsley.
